eFIXX tests SOL•THOR: Direct PV-powered hot water without an inverter
The popular electrical installation YouTube channel eFIXX has put the my-PV SOL•THOR DC Power Manager to the test. In a new installation video, the team demonstrates how photovoltaic modules can be connected directly to a hot water cylinder – without an inverter and without a grid connection.
An 18-module PV system powers the property, with three modules dedicated exclusively to domestic hot water generation and connected directly to SOL•THOR. The video follows the entire installation process, from unboxing and wiring to commissioning and monitoring in the my-PV Cloud. Along the way, the eFIXX team explains the device's key features and demonstrates how easy it is to convert sunlight directly into hot water.
Dedicated PV for water heating is becoming increasingly relevant as grid regulations evolve. It is an ideal solution where inverter capacity is limited, grid export is restricted or curtailed, additional AC-coupled PV cannot be connected, or in off-grid applications where no grid connection is available. By assigning a separate PV string exclusively to hot water generation, homeowners can cover a significant share of their annual domestic hot water demand with solar energy while maximising the value of every kilowatt-hour produced.
Hot water directly from PV
The SOL•THOR is a 0 to 3.6 kW linearly controlled DC Power Manager that converts photovoltaic energy directly into heat. Instead of feeding electricity into the grid, it transfers the DC power from photovoltaic modules directly and with minimal losses to an immersion heater. Since the device operates completely independently of the electricity grid, no inverter or grid connection is required.
Another key advantage is its flexibility. SOL•THOR can be used with one to ten PV modules and is compatible with both new and existing hot water cylinders. Existing immersion heaters can often continue to be used, making it a simple and cost-effective solution for retrofitting solar hot water generation.
